14:22 — During the second phase of the Oxbridge ORM refactor, the migration shim briefly exposed raw query construction without the parameter-binding wrapper. The team at Fernhollow caught it in review before deployment; no tainted build reached production. For audit purposes, we verified that every artifact promoted that afternoon was compiled after the shim was corrected. The earliest clean artifact, which the security review should treat as the baseline, carries the token recorded below.

pipeline stamp: htk14_87f419ab459f6d

## Deployment: Load testing the checkout flow

Before any production release of the Tindervale checkout service, run the full load suite against the staging cluster in the Ostrander region. The suite simulates 5,000 concurrent carts with realistic payment retries; anything above a 0.5% error rate blocks the deploy. Note for security review: the load generator uses synthetic card data only and never touches the live payment gateway. The generator reads its target environment and throttling parameters from the block below.

config for yagug-fahop:
[druax]
port = 9090
region = west-2
host = druax.qorvelsys.internal
timeout_ms = 3000
retries = 8

## 3.8.1 — Key rotation

Rotated the package-signing key for Fabricant, our test-data factory library, after the old one passed its two-year policy window. Artifacts from 3.8.1 onward verify only against the new key; older releases remain valid under the archived one. Update your verification config to use the new public key below.

signing key of bagap-yawep = bky13_TbfT6ZMUoGJo2

## v3.8.1 — DedupeEngine key rotation

Rotated release signing key for the MergeMatch customer-record deduplication service. Old key retired after the Calverton audit. All dedup batch artifacts from this release forward are signed with the replacement. Verify checksums before promoting to prod. No functional changes to match scoring or merge rules. New signing key follows.

rollout seal: bky9_PeXH1fTLY